Du bist nicht angemeldet.

1

Dienstag, 18. Mai 2004, 09:44

Seiten bewerten

Hallo,

habe mal mehrere Designs für einen Kunden entworfen. Könnt Ihr Euch die mal bitte anschauen und bewerten.
Also Design und Quellcode.

Hier Design 1:
http://www.der-belegungsplan.de/Baumtraum/index2.php

Design 2:
http://www.der-belegungsplan.de/Baumtraum/index3.php

Design 3:
http://www.der-belegungsplan.de/Baumtraum/index4.php

Vielen Dank schonmal!
Signatur von »ARESOL« wieder da

2

Dienstag, 18. Mai 2004, 11:40

RE: Seiten bewerten

Hi,
das erste gefällt mir am besten, lediglich das Blumentopfbild sollte direkt am linken Rand stehen und die Überschrift wirkt auf dem angegrauten Hintergrund nicht optimal. Beim zweiten Design stört mich der Freiraum und das dritte wirkt zu gedrängt.

Die Umsetzung ist jedoch fehlerhaft und führt bei anderen Browsern als dem IE auch zu Fehldarstellungen. Das Problem ist das Box-Modell i.V. mit Positionsangaben. Der Quellcode ist zwar aufgeräumt, enthält aber überflüssige DIVs.
Dieses Layout läßt sich problenmlos ohne "position" realisieren - sieh' Dir meine Umsetzung zu Deinem anderen Thread an...

Bei den Einheiten zur Breite solltest Du statt pt px verwenden und dem body mit font-size:101% definieren, um Bugs beim IE zu vermeiden.
Gruß
Ingo

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»Ingo« (18. Mai 2004, 11:41)


3

Dienstag, 18. Mai 2004, 11:50

Hi ARESOL,

noch kann man zu Deiner Seite nicht wirklich viel sagen, da außer ein wenig Blindtext ja nicht viel vorhanden ist... ;)

Bau doch schnon mal die Maus-Effekte für die Navigation ein. Dadurch wirkt auch eine Testseite schon etwas "lebendiger" aus...

Hier, was mir auf die Schnelle aufgefallen ist:

- Die Hintergrundfarbe (dieses Dünnpfiff-Braunton) und das Rot der Navigationsleiste harmonieren nicht wirklich, finde ich.

- Der FireFox und Opera zeigen beide ein merkwürdiges Verhalten in bezug auf den Header. Zusätzlich entsteht im Opera eine Zeile, in welcher der Hintergrund durchscheint.

Beides siehe: >>Screenshot

Eine Sache noch: Wenn Du bei der gleichen Seite nur dreimal den Header ein wenig umgestaltest, finde ich es etwas "überzogen" von drei Designs zu sprechen... ;)

Soweit auf die Schnelle...

LapisInfernalis
Signatur von »LapisInfernalis« Eine Milde Gabe...

Der Horizont vieler Menschen ist ein Kreis mit dem Radius Null - und das nennen sie ihren Standpunkt.

Albert Einstein (1879-1955)

A common mistake people make when trying to design something completely foolproof is to underestimate the ingenuity of complete fools.
Douglas Adams (1952-2001)

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»LapisInfernalis« (18. Mai 2004, 11:50)


4

Dienstag, 18. Mai 2004, 12:17

Danke schonmal.
Bezüglich Design ode rnicht hast Du sicherlich recht. Sind keine verschiedenen Designs! ;-).

Welche Divs, sind den überflüßig? Und warum sollte man ohne position arbeiten?
Signatur von »ARESOL« wieder da

5

Dienstag, 18. Mai 2004, 12:36

Für den Header brauchst Du z.B. nur einen Div und nicht einen Extra für die Grafik. Das im übrigen ist auch ein Grund dafür, dass das Bild im Opera und FireFox so merkwürdig aussieht.

Was Ingo mit der Positions-Angabe meint siehst Du am besten, wenn Du Dir seine Beispielseite in Deinem "mein Menü verschiebt sich"-Threadansiehst...
Signatur von »LapisInfernalis« Eine Milde Gabe...

Der Horizont vieler Menschen ist ein Kreis mit dem Radius Null - und das nennen sie ihren Standpunkt.

Albert Einstein (1879-1955)

A common mistake people make when trying to design something completely foolproof is to underestimate the ingenuity of complete fools.
Douglas Adams (1952-2001)

6

Dienstag, 18. Mai 2004, 12:45

Mit den Divs zu viel hab ich mir angeschaut im anderen Thread, aber ist das denn wirklich so schlimm? Das mit der Grafik ändere ich mal schnel, dass sehe ich ja auch noch ein, aber warum sollte man denn bei DIV-Containern sparen. Die Ladezeiten werden dadurch doch nicht wirklich beeinträchtigt, oder?
Und der Quellcode ist immer noch übrsichtlich, oder etwa nicht?
Signatur von »ARESOL« wieder da

7

Dienstag, 18. Mai 2004, 13:01

Es geht nicht darum, dass ein DIV mehr oder weniger die Ladezeit verändert oder den Quellcode unübersichtlicher macht.

Es ist mehr eine Prinzipfrage, dass man versucht, nur mit den notwendigen Mitteln sein Ziel zu erreichen. So dass Du z.B. keine Elemente verwendest, die _eigentlich_ unnötig sind.

Ein kleines (wenn auch zugegeben an den Haaren herbei gezogenes) Beispiel:

Angenommen, Du möchtest ein Bild aufhängen. Dafür könntest Du z.B. einen angemessen großen Nagel nehmen, ihn in die Wand hauen und das Bild daran aufhängen...

Da Du aber keinen großen Nagel nehmen kannst/willst oder keinen hast und nicht extra in den Baumarkt rennen willst, nimmst Du vier kleine Nägel die Du noch immer Keller hast. Damit Du sie verwenden kannst, klebst Du noch drei weitere Aufhängungen, die Du von den Rückseiten alter Bilder abgenommen hast, welche Du entsorgen willst, auf die Rückseite Deines Bildes.

Jetzt schlägst Du alle vier Nägel in die Wand und hängst das Bild auf.

Das Bild wird auf diese Weise hängen bleiben, niemals herunter fallen und nach außen sieht man keinen Unterschied, ob Du einen oder was weiß ich wieviele Nägel verwendet hast.

Willst Du aber die Wand für etwas anderes benutzen, oder umgestalten, hast Du ein Problem.

In a nutshell: Wenn Du mehr Elemente verwendest, als eigentlich nötig, dann musst Du auch entsprechend mehr Elemente überarbeiten, wenn z.B. im CSS etwas geändert wird. Bei einem einzigen Element mag dies vernachlässigbar erscheinen, aber mit voranschreitender Du machst Deinen Quellcode und Dein Layout dadurch künstlich etwas "unflexibler", bzw. fehleranfälliger.

Denn jedes zusätzliche (und vor allem unnötige) Element ist irgendwo auch eine zusätzliche potentielle Fehlerquelle...
Signatur von »LapisInfernalis« Eine Milde Gabe...

Der Horizont vieler Menschen ist ein Kreis mit dem Radius Null - und das nennen sie ihren Standpunkt.

Albert Einstein (1879-1955)

A common mistake people make when trying to design something completely foolproof is to underestimate the ingenuity of complete fools.
Douglas Adams (1952-2001)

8

Dienstag, 18. Mai 2004, 13:35

Ich lass mir das mal durch den Kopf gehen, okay? Was man so weg machen kann.

Würde mich jetzt aber noch über viele weitere Meinungen bezüglich der verschiedenen Header freuen. Da ich diesbezüglich sehr unentschlossen bin.
Signatur von »ARESOL« wieder da

9

Dienstag, 18. Mai 2004, 14:10

Hi,
schönes Beispiel mit dem Bildaufhängen.
ergänzend vielleicht noch, daß DIV und SPAN bedeutungslose Elemente sind, die nur dann verwendet werden sollten, wenn keine für den Zweck passende Elemente vorhanden sind. Gerade bei DIVs läuft man leicht Gefahr, eine "Div-Suppe" zu erzeugen, die im Endeffekt auch nicht besser als verschachtelte Tabellen sind.
Obwohl... es gibt auch Fälle, in denen eine solche Verschachtelung wieder Sinn macht, z.B. in http://www.1ngo.de/web/zielscheibe.html ;-)
Gruß
Ingo